Transaction 39338a210a640cbfef9dac3b481a08ae8b0973148de8915b76c022aa83ab30ed

1 Input
2 Outputs
  • 39338a210a640cbfef9dac3b481a08ae8b0973148de8915b76c022aa83ab30ed:0
  • value  961240167
    address  3PhbATssyVSHWQ6yVuRgXoqTRmVr9v2zb1
  • 39338a210a640cbfef9dac3b481a08ae8b0973148de8915b76c022aa83ab30ed:1
  • value  38750000
    address  1H6RRFdooPj1GKVD4JWfhgzNFGkNZebAz3